The area around Ozu City is rich in history and natural beauty. An interesting local fact is that Ozu is often called "Little Kyoto of Iyo" due to its well-preserved historical streetscape along the Hijikawa River. The closest major tourist attraction is the stunning Ozu Castle, a reconstructed hilltop castle offering panoramic views of the city and the surrounding countryside, located approximately 6.5km from the property.
